The recent developments in the virtual agent technology are directly influenced by the advancement of AI which is contributing to the health intelligence virtual assistance market. Virtual agents are also known as an intelligent virtual agent, chatbot, or virtual representative that provides automated services using an AI enabled program to the customers. Virtual agents provide technical, professional, administrative and creative assistance to the customers. 

Virtual nursing assistance acts as a vocal assistant for an individual and assists in the necessary treatment procedures. It is constantly assisting doctors in making appropriate decisions on the basis of predictions been made prior to the development of the disease. Therefore, based on the prior predictions, the surgeons operate an individual more precisely and it further enables the researchers to analyze even complex data with more ease.

AI-based chatbots and other applications further support in providing care to an individual by offering nursing assistance facility even after discharge from the hospital. This feature aids in simplifying the facility of outpatient services along with an increase in monitoring patient compliance after the discharge of a patient. AI-enabled virtual nursing assistance services can be accessed on smartphones and on other wearable devices, through which it reminds the patient regarding their routine medications and encourage the patient to follow routine exercises.

Recent Initiatives related to health intelligence virtual assistance market:

Reflexion Health, a US-based hospital and health care service provider, has developed a Virtual Exercise Rehabilitation Assistant (VERA) program in 2018, which guides patients during physical therapy exercises, monitors the progression of the disease, and enable the individual in proper assessment of diseases.

IBM Corp.in 2017, developed an Arthritis Virtual Assistant program for the Arthritis Research UK. The program provides personalized information along with advice concerning medicines, exercise, and diet through proper interactions with patients.

MyCallBell, an app developed by the US-based healthcare services provider aims at providing immediate virtual nursing assistance programs to patients who have concerns and questions regarding their health. It provides on-demand virtual nursing service to the patients via standard telephone or smartphone access or through video-chat services. 

Telehealth Services, a US-based healthcare service provider, has developed an iCare Navigator platform in 2017, which incorporates virtual nurses in the system, named Elizabeth and Louise. These nurses coach patients regarding the management of the diseases, which includes timely medications and routine exercises.
